Summer school in Mexico city featuring courses in modern areas of Probability.
29 Jun-3 Jul 2026 Mexico city (Mexico)

XI School in Probability and Stochastic processes

Event poster

The event offers an overview of major research directions in probability and stochastic processes, introducing advanced students and researchers to current topics, key ideas, and central methods in the field. 

Held biennially since 1998, the School has become a major regional event, known for its world-class lecturers and its role in fostering collaboration and disseminating frontier research in probability and stochastic processes. To see last edition's webpage, visit https://proyectos.matem.unam.mx/xeppe.

This edition is jointly organized by the Institute of Mathematics of the UNAM and CIMAT, Guanajuato, with additional support from LAREMA in Angers, France. It will be followed by a research workshop framed within the same French–Mexican collaboration, further strengthening academic ties and stimulating new joint research initiatives.

Courses in this edition

  • Jorge Garza Vargas (California Institute of Technology) Strong Convergence of Random Matrices

  • Saraí Hernández Torres (Universidad Nacional Autónoma de México)  The Geometry of the Uniform Spanning Tree in Three Dimensions

  • Justin Salez (Université Paris Dauphine, CEREMADE) Modern Aspects of Markov Chains: Entropy, Curvature and the Cutoff Phenomenon

  • Paul Thévenin (Université d’Angers, LAREMA) Introduction to the Infinite Noodle

These courses explore cutting-edge and highly interdisciplinary topics that lie at the interface of probability with analysis, combinatorics, geometry, among others. In addition to the minicourses, the program includes plenary lectures by French and Mexican researchers working in various areas of probability and stochastic processes, showcasing active lines of research and encouraging further interaction among participants.
